Funnel score
8-point CRO breakdown
How well the landing page behind the ad is built to convert, scored across 8 factors: offer, copy, speed, trust, mobile, message-match, CTA, and social proof.
This page excels at storytelling and trust-building through detailed personal narrative, authentic product photography, and credible social proof (TSS Approved badge, editor endorsement). The headline and offer directly match the ad promise about the dog food switch and visible results. However, the page suffers from critical speed issues (38 PageSpeed score), which undermines conversion potential, and the primary CTA ("Shop Now") is somewhat buried within the featured product section rather than prominently positioned. Mobile optimization appears adequate but the slow load time will hurt mobile users disproportionately. The message match is strong, but technical performance and CTA prominence are the main conversion killers.
What this funnel does right. Steal these.
- Headline: The headline 'I Didn't Think Fresh Dog Food Would Be Worth the Cost - Then I Tried Ollie' directly mirrors the ad promise and creates compelling curiosity about the transformation.
- Message match: Page content perfectly aligns with ad messaging: discusses the food switch decision, visible results (shinier coat, calmer stomach, dog's enthusiasm), and editor/personal endorsement.
- Trust signals: Strong trust signals include TSS Approved badge, detailed personal narrative with specific dog information, authentic product photography, ingredient transparency, and veterinary/expert credentials mentioned for Ollie's development.
- Social proof: Page includes TSS Approved badge, editor endorsement from The Splendid Shopper, detailed personal testimonial with specific dog details (Boo, 5-year-old golden retriever), and multiple before/after lifestyle photos showing product usage.
- Offer clarity: The offer is clearly presented as 'OLLIE Full Fresh Meat Plan' with a prominent 'Shop Now' button, though pricing details ($1.57+ per meal) are mentioned lower in the content.
- Mobile experience: Layout appears responsive with stacked content sections suitable for mobile, though the slow PageSpeed score (38) will severely impact mobile user experience and load times.
Where it's weak
- Page speed: PageSpeed score of 38 is critically poor, indicating significant performance issues that will cause high bounce rates and poor mobile experience.
